how many miles does everyone typically get out of a pair of lunar racers?
I train all of my miles in Lunar Racers. You'll get a ton of miles out of them. None of this replacing after 300 miles stuff. The limiting factor on when you replace them is when the upper starts to get stretched out because then your foot becomes unstable. The sole outlasts the rest of the shoe.
I use them once in a while. I find the Lunar Montreals are pretty close. They seem like they are flimsy but seem to work once you have them on. Pretty good on the treadmill but like another poster; would like to see a trail version.
I swap between the LR for most runs and the Free 3.0 for easy stuff. Unlike the guy above, I do limit the mileage on the shoe. When it gets close to 400 I use it for a trail only/ rainy day shoe before I toss it at 500. I would rather be safe and avoid injury and at about $70 close-outs are cheap. LR works well for me. I did like the first series best. I know they say they went back after the LR2 but for some reason I can't get the same feel.
Thats because Nike changed the foam after version one and didn't tell anybody, it was lunarlite in the early versions but changed to lunarlon midway through the life of LR1, a heavier less bouncey, less responsive material.... its stayed lunarlon ever since. What a con.
